Sacrificing of cattle in the way of Allah is a great act of worship. However, some Scholars are of the opinion that it is ‘Wajib’ (obligatory). S acrifice of animal or Qurbani on the day of Eid al Adha is a confirmed Sunnah of not only Prophet Ibrahim (A.S.) but also of our beloved Prophet Mohammad (S.A.W.).
